摘要

低效的能源定价阻碍了许多国家的经济发展。我们研究了中国最近的供暖改革的长期影响,该改革以个人计量定价取代了常用的固定支付系统。利用错开的政策推出和家庭日常供暖消费的行政数据,我们发现,改革导致了供暖使用量的长期减少,并产生了可观的福利收益。消费者逐渐学会了如何有效地节约供暖,使短期评估低估了政策的影响。我们的研究结果表明,能源价格改革是提高发展中国家配置效率和空气质量的有效途径,在这些国家,未计量的低效率定价仍然普遍存在。

Reforming Inefficient Energy Pricing: Evidence from China
Inefficient energy pricing hinders economic development in many countries. We examine long-run effects of a recent heating reform in China that replaced a commonly-used fixed-payment system with individually-metered pricing. Using staggered policy rollouts and administrative data on household-level daily heating consumption, we find that the reform induced long-run reductions in heating usage and generated substantial welfare gains. Consumers gradually learned how to conserve heating effectively, making short-run evaluations underestimate the policy impacts. Our results suggest that energy price reform is an effective way to improve allocative efficiency and air quality in developing countries, where unmetered-inefficient pricing is still ubiquitous.
